Functional Description ? help Back to Top
Source Description
UniProtTranscription factor that binds 5'-AACGG-3' motifs in gene promoters (By similarity). Transcription repressor that regulates organ growth. Binds to the promoters of G2/M-specific genes and to E2F target genes to prevent their expression in post-mitotic cells and to restrict the time window of their expression in proliferating cells (PubMed:26069325). {ECO:0000250|UniProtKB:Q94FL9, ECO:0000269|PubMed:26069325}.
